K896222 is an FDA 510(k) clearance for the FREE THYROXINE (FT4) RADIOIMMUNOASSAY KIT. Classified as Radioimmunoassay, Free Thyroxine (product code CEC), Class II - Special Controls.

Submitted by Nichols Institute Diagnostics (Los Angeles, US). The FDA issued a Cleared decision on November 17, 1989 after a review of 18 days - a notably fast clearance cycle.

This device falls under the Chemistry FDA review panel, regulated under 21 CFR 862.1695 - the FDA in vitro diagnostics and chemistry framework. The Traditional 510(k) pathway establishes clearance through substantial equivalence to a legally marketed predicate device, without requiring clinical trial data.

What this classification means

Class II devices require demonstration of substantial equivalence to a legally marketed predicate device. This pathway does not require clinical trials - it relies on engineering equivalence and performance data. Most Chemistry devices follow this clearance model.
